Known Site Issues & Fixes

Purpose: This page tracks technical bugs, quirks, and configuration issues specific to this wiki's setup — things like namespace-scoped template failures, extension configuration gaps, or parser quirks that cost real time to diagnose. It exists so a fix (or a failed fix attempt) only has to be discovered once, not rediscovered from scratch the next time the same symptom shows up on a different page.

What This Page Is For

  • Technical/infrastructure bugs — template logic errors, namespace-specific failures, extension configuration issues (e.g. SMW settings), broken parser functions, Lua module errors.
  • Issues that are specific to this wiki's setup, not general MediaWiki knowledge easily found elsewhere.
  • Issues worth recording even when unresolved — a documented failed fix attempt saves the next person from retrying the same dead end.

What This Page Is NOT For

  • Content calibration findings — those belong in a page's own Calibration Report (Talk page or `/Calibration Log`), not here.
  • Governance/taxonomy decisions — those belong in Decision Records: Governance Memory, not here.
  • Open conceptual questions — those belong as a breadcrumb on the relevant page itself, not here, unless the question is specifically about a technical mechanism.
  • General MediaWiki documentation — if the answer is "read the MediaWiki manual," it doesn't need an entry here. This page is for things specific to how this wiki is configured, not general platform knowledge.

Rule of thumb: if fixing it required understanding something specific about *this* wiki's configuration or *this* project's templates — not just MediaWiki in general — it belongs here.

How to Use This Page

  • Reports and discussion about entries on this page happen on this page's Talk page — not inline here. This page stays a clean, scannable log; the reasoning, back-and-forth, and any dispute about a fix lives on Talk.
  • When you find or fix an issue, add an entry below using the format in How to Add an Entry.
  • When you attempt a fix that doesn't work, record that too — a documented failed attempt is genuinely valuable; it prevents the next person from repeating it.
  • Mark status honestly: Open (unresolved), Mitigated (workaround exists, root cause not fixed), or Resolved (actually fixed).
